Inflammation is the starting point for nearly all diseases. From arthritis to certain cancers, inflammation is a key component. Certain blood tests can tell us if you have inflammation going on but not where.

Shirley talks about the secret places you’ll find inflammation, and how inflammation contributes to many of life’s ills.

Charles Whitney, M.D. is double boarded in Family Medicine and Sports Medicine. He graduated from Jefferson Medical College in Philadelphia and completed his family practice residency at David Grant USAF Medical Center. He served as a physician in the United States Air Force before joining the University of Pennsylvania Health System, where he established his Direct Primary Care practice, Revolutionary Health Services, in 2003.

He served on the Board of Directors of the American Academy of Private Physicians, the national trade organization of Direct Primary Care practices from 2007-2013, and was Vice-president from May 2012 to May 2013.  He was recently named a “Top Doc” in Concierge Medicine by Concierge Medicine Today, the only physician in Pennsylvania to earn that distinction in 2013.  Dr. Whitney is a member of the Editorial Advisory Board of Pennwell Publishers, a leading provider of peer-reviewed continuing education credits and is a member of the steering committee of the Direct Primary Care Coalition.
